Chairman Of Commission II Of The DPR: It Is Reasonable That The Celebration Of The 80th Anniversary Of The Republic Of Indonesia Will Not Be Held At IKN, The Presidential Decree Has Not Yet Come Out

JAKARTA - Chairman of Commission II of the House of Representatives, Rifqinizamy Karsayuda, considers it natural that the celebration of Indonesia's 80th Anniversary on August 17 will not be held in the capital city of the archipelago, and will again be concentrated in DKI Jakarta.

The reason is, although the capital city of Nusantara has been stipulated in the law as the capital city of the country, the Presidential Decree (Keppres) on this matter has not been officially issued.

"One in terms of normative, although Law number 3 of 2022 concerning the Capital City of the Archipelago, it has stated that the Capital City of the Archipelago is our National Capital, but in the law it is also stated that the activation or activation of the IKN as the State Capital must be regulated in a Presidential Decree," said Rifqi at the Paleman Complex, Senayan, Jakarta, Wednesday, July 23.

"Until now, we are still waiting for the President's decision. So that in a juridically, normatively, Jakarta serves as the State Capital. So it is very natural that the celebration of the 80th Anniversary of the Republic of Indonesia still culminates in Jakarta," he continued.

Rifqi also assessed that the budget efficiency imposed by President Prabowo Subianto's government was also the reason for celebrating the Indonesian independence day in Jakarta. Because celebrating at IKN requires a lot of money.

"In accordance with the spirit of Presidential Impress number 1 of 2025 concerning budget efficiency, if we refer to celebrations that have been held there, we will certainly use a large budget. Especially for transportation, for accommodation, because people who will celebrate at IKN are still living in Jakarta, still active in Jakarta," he said.

Therefore, the member of the DPR's NasDem Faction said that his party proposed that President Prabowo issue a Presidential Decree to accelerate the development and transfer of ministries/agencies to IKN. And suggested that Vice President Gibran Rakabuming Raka be based there.

If you have not been able to determine IKN as the state capital by issuing the Presidential Decree, NasDem assesses that the moratorium needs to be considered.

"Well, that's why my party, the NasDem party, asked for a quick decision by the President so that we immediately decide IKN as the State Capital through the Presidential Decree," concluded Rifqinizamy.
